Cafta overcomes important hurdle

By Christopher Swann in Washington

Published: June 15 2005 23:55 | Last updated: June 15 2005 23:55

The Central American Free Trade Agreement cleared an important hurdle in the US Congress on Wednesday, winning a solid majority in the influential ways and means committee.

An informal poll on the committee showed 25 in favour to 16 against. The vote was largely split along party lines. But two Democrats broke ranks with their party in support of Cafta.
